Lincoln City Council Districts 1,3,5 General

Election Date:May 12, 2026Register by:April 27, 2026
Current holder:Maria Gonzalez(Democratic)

The Lincoln City Council Districts 1, 3, and 5 general election on May 12, 2026, will determine representation for three of the city's seven council districts. Voters in these districts will elect council members to serve four-year terms, with responsibilities including local ordinances, budget approval, and city planning.

How to Vote

To vote in Lincoln, Nebraska, residents must register by April 27, 2026, either online via the Nebraska Secretary of State's voter portal, by mail, or in person at the Lancaster County Election Office. On election day, polls are open from 8:00 AM to 8:00 PM CT; early voting begins April 20 and runs through May 11 at designated locations, and voters must present a valid photo ID such as a Nebraska driver's license, state ID, or passport.
